      Corporate Risk Investigation Analyst Interview

      Aug 21, 2016
      Anonymous Interview Candidate
      Budapest
      No offer
      Positive experience
      Average interview

      Application

      I applied online. The process took 4 weeks. I interviewed at KPMG (Budapest) in Jul 2016

      Interview

      First stage is screening interview, do not think that it matters. After this you get a link to an online assessment. There are four parts. English grammar test (~ 20 questions, easy if you actually know language :) Logic test. English summary test (ask you to write short pieces about yourselves and some current news). Skill test (they give you a few news articles about some firm and you have to summarize all risk-related points). If you pass they call you for interview with team leader. If you pass that one as well then there will be an interview with partner (looks more like formality to me).

      Interview questions [1]

      Question 1

      Your motivation, background, language knowledge (rumor has it that sometimes they test it, did not happen to me).
